These are Corner Frames with dimensions fitting standard 2x3, 2x4, and 2x6 lumber. The side holes are for 1/4 inch bolts. I've placed spaces in the vertical shafts in each corner frame for 1/4 inch square nuts I got at Lowe's. These are to be placed when the print pauses then restart print and they are sealed in place. These are to allow stacking/bolting Cope and Drag together in casting. I used PRUSA's 3D Color Print app to set the stop positions/color change stops. The measurements for these stops can be determined in Slicer prior to sending G-code to 3D color app. I've already done the 2x3s so these stop positions are at 12.35 mm and 56.75mm the others you'll have to figure out and I will update this post when I do them in future. Also have included STEP and Parasolid files from my Onshape account for those wishing to customize further. Enjoy!
